Revolutionizing Education: Bennett School’s AI-Driven Model Slashes Classroom Time to Two Hours
Transforming Traditional Schooling: Bennett School’s AI-Enhanced Learning Framework
In a bold move to reshape education, Houston’s Bennett School has introduced a pioneering AI-based learning system that condenses the conventional school day to just two hours of in-person instruction. This cutting-edge model leverages sophisticated artificial intelligence to customize learning experiences outside the classroom, enabling students to progress at their own pace through interactive platforms and continuous performance monitoring. School leaders highlight that this reduction in classroom hours opens up opportunities for students to engage more deeply in collaborative projects, creative endeavors, and self-directed study, promoting a well-rounded educational journey.
Advocates of the new system emphasize several advantages, such as:
- Increased motivation through individualized lesson plans
- Lower stress levels and enhanced mental well-being
- Greater availability for extracurricular and social engagements
However, detractors express reservations including:
- Reduced direct interaction with teachers
- Disparities in access to necessary technology among students
- Concerns about maintaining academic standards and performance on standardized assessments
| Feature | Bennett School’s AI Model | Conventional Education |
|---|---|---|
| Classroom Duration | 2 hours daily | 6 to 7 hours daily |
| AI Integration | Embedded in all lessons | Rare or absent |
| Student Independence | High – personalized pathways | Low – fixed curriculum |
| Time for Extracurriculars | Significantly increased | Generally limited |
Concerns from Educators and Families Regarding the Compressed School Day
The introduction of a two-hour classroom day at Bennett School has sparked apprehension among teachers and parents alike. Many educators argue that such a truncated schedule may compromise the depth and quality of instruction, especially in disciplines that benefit from hands-on activities and critical analysis. Teachers worry that diminished face-to-face time could hinder personalized support and reduce collaborative learning opportunities essential for student development. Parents also voice unease about the potential effects on their children’s social skills and readiness for college-level academics.
Moreover, critics highlight that the rapid transition to a technology-centric, shortened day might widen existing educational disparities. While AI can tailor learning experiences, unequal access to digital devices and reliable internet at home remains a significant barrier for some students. The table below summarizes the main points raised during recent stakeholder discussions:
| Group | Primary Concern | Recommended Solution |
|---|---|---|
| Teachers | Insufficient instructional time | Increase in-person hours or provide supplemental tutoring |
| Parents | Impact on social and emotional growth | Incorporate structured social and extracurricular programs |
| Education Specialists | Unequal technology access | Develop initiatives for equitable distribution of digital resources |

Strategies for Harmonizing AI Integration with Traditional Teaching to Foster Student Achievement
To harness AI’s advantages without sacrificing the benefits of conventional education, experts recommend adopting a blended instructional model. This approach combines AI-driven personalized learning with direct teacher-led sessions, ensuring students receive tailored support while developing essential social and cognitive skills. Educators continue to play a crucial role as mentors and facilitators, especially in complex subject areas where human insight is indispensable. Key strategies include:
- Designated AI Learning Periods: Schedule specific blocks during the school day for AI-based activities, balanced with interactive teacher-led lessons and group work.
- Teacher Training Programs: Provide ongoing professional development to help educators effectively integrate AI tools while maintaining sound pedagogical practices.
- Comprehensive Assessment Systems: Use a combination of AI-generated data and qualitative evaluations to gain a holistic understanding of student progress.
Schools experimenting with condensed schedules like Bennett’s should strive for a thoughtful equilibrium that leverages technology’s efficiencies without neglecting the irreplaceable value of human interaction. The following framework illustrates a balanced division of a two-hour school day:
| Activity | Time Allocation | Objective |
|---|---|---|
| AI-Driven Personalized Learning | 45 minutes | Adaptive skill development and targeted remediation |
| Teacher-Facilitated Discussions & Social Learning | 45 minutes | Enhancing critical thinking and peer collaboration |
| Hands-On Projects & Creative Activities | 30 minutes | Applying concepts and fostering innovation |
